Abstract Studying the response of bridge due to temperature effects is the main aim of this paper. The Fu-Sui bridge is constructed on a hard environmental effect region in China. To evaluate and assessment the behavior of this bridge, a finite element model and Structural Health Monitoring System (SHM) are used. In addition, the output only model identification is used to assess the thermal response and displacement of bridge. The results of the finite element and monitoring system reveal to that the behavior of the bridge after the first working year is safe, but over a long time period the low temperatures will have an effect on the behavior of the bridge, especially for the upper girder monitoring points. The thermal response and displacement output of the model used conforms with the SHM measurements. Also, the models calculated can be used to detect the bridge behavior in future time monitoring.
